Why Fragrance-Free Matters for Sensitive Skin

Fragrance—whether natural or synthetic—is one of the leading causes of contact dermatitis and skin irritation. Even if your skin doesn't react immediately, repeated exposure can weaken the skin barrier over time, leading to increased sensitivity, dryness, and inflammation. For those with conditions like eczema or rosacea, fragrance can trigger flare-ups that are difficult to calm. That's why dermatologists often recommend fragrance-free products as the first step in a sensitive skin routine.

Choosing fragrance-free doesn't mean sacrificing sensory pleasure. Many modern formulas use mild, non-irritating ingredients like glycerin, ceramides, and niacinamide to deliver hydration and comfort. The key is to read labels carefully: terms like 'unscented' can still contain masking fragrances, while 'fragrance-free' means no added perfume of any kind. Step 2: Hydrate with a Fragrance-Free Moisturizer

Moisturizing is crucial for sensitive skin because a healthy barrier locks in moisture and keeps irritants out. Look for ingredients like ceramides, glycerin, squalane, and niacinamide, which support barrier repair and calm inflammation. A fragrance-free moisturizer should feel lightweight yet nourishing, absorbing quickly without leaving a greasy residue. Applying it to damp skin helps seal in hydration.

Step 3: Protect with a Fragrance-Free Sunscreen

Sun protection is non-negotiable for sensitive skin, as UV rays can trigger inflammation and worsen conditions like rosacea. Choose a mineral sunscreen with zinc oxide or titanium dioxide—these ingredients sit on the skin's surface and reflect UV rays without chemical irritation. Many physical sunscreens are fragrance-free and formulated for sensitive skin. Look for SPF 30 or higher and broad-spectrum protection.

Additional Tips for a Complete Fragrance-Free Routine

Beyond the basics, consider adding a fragrance-free serum for targeted concerns. Niacinamide serums help reduce redness, while hyaluronic acid boosts hydration. Avoid retinol and strong exfoliants if your skin is highly reactive—stick to gentle actives like polyhydroxy acids. Patch test any new product on your inner arm before applying to your face.

Also, don't forget your hair and scalp care. Fragrance in shampoos and conditioners can irritate sensitive skin, especially if it runs down your face.
